Activities - how the charity spends its money
SWSW provides: 1. Music Therapy for children by State Registered Music Therapists in North Cornwall and North West Devon. 2. A free Instrument Loan Scheme (ILS) to school children having lessons within the SWSW catchment area 3. Annual music workshops for schools with professional musicians 4. An annual award to a music student who has shown exceptional improvement in difficult circumstances

Charitable objects
TO ADVANCE PUBLIC EDUCATION IN MUSIC, ART, DRAMA AND DANCE AND THE RELIEF OF SICKNESS IN PARTICULAR THROUGH THE PROVISION OF MUSIC, ART, DRAMA AND DANCE THERAPIES.
